The 神马福利影片's Innovation Success Highlighted in Latest Knowledge Exchange Framework (KEF) Assessment
The 神马福利影片 has once again excelled in the latest KEF assessment, surpassing the sector average in several key areas of knowledge exchange.
Warwick鈥檚 performance in business engagement and research partnerships demonstrates its leadership in fostering collaboration, driving innovation, and contributing to societal progress.
Warwick鈥檚 business engagement efforts continue to set a high standard, reflecting its strong partnerships with both local and global enterprises. Its research collaborations further solidify the university鈥檚 reputation for creating impactful, world-leading research.
Research partnerships at Warwick were praised for their impact. Partnerships abroad including the Warwick-Monash Alliance, are matched with regional efforts to work collaboratively, including the Warwick Innovation District.
Programmes hosted at Warwick, including the NatWest business accelerator, show the University鈥檚 commitment to supporting local businesses, whether large or small.
Vice-Chancellor of The 神马福利影片, Professor Stuart Croft, commented: 鈥淥ur performance in the latest KEF assessment showcases our continued leadership in driving innovation and collaboration across industries and communities.
鈥淭hese results reflect the tireless efforts of our staff, students, and partners who are deeply committed to turning knowledge into impactful action.鈥
Warwick has been ranked above its peers in large, research-intensive universities for both working with business and community engagement, with the KEF noting 鈥榲ery high engagement鈥 in both these areas.
One key highlight is Warwick鈥檚 success in working with businesses, where its partnerships continue to drive economic and technological advancements. A notable example is the University鈥檚 collaboration with Jaguar Land Rover through Warwick Manufacturing Group (WMG).
WMG and JLR have a long-standing collaboration in the field of research and development. Over the years, we have invested millions in infrastructure and equipment together, alongside supporting skills and education programmes.
The Knowledge Exchange Framework (KEF) measures the success of UK higher education institutions in knowledge exchange activities, such as research commercialization, support for businesses, and local engagement.
Warwick鈥檚 achievements underscore its pivotal role in driving economic growth and societal progress both regionally and internationally.
